Top Compass Group competitors

Compass Group competitors include Sodexo, Aramark, Elior Group, ISS and ABM Industries.

Sodexo

Global Facilities ManagementEnterprise

Sodexo competes with Compass Group in providing comprehensive food and facilities management services for corporate and educational sectors. While Compass Group focuses on a decentralized brand portfolio, Sodexo emphasizes a unified global service model. Buyers often choose Sodexo for its integrated workplace experience solutions and extensive sustainability reporting capabilities.

Aramark

Food and Uniform ServicesEnterprise

Aramark competes with Compass Group in the institutional foodservice market, particularly within healthcare and higher education. Unlike Compass Group, which maintains a heavy focus on premium culinary experiences, Aramark differentiates itself through its robust uniform and facility supply chain, offering a more diversified service bundle for large-scale enterprise clients.

Elior Group

Contract Catering ServicesEnterprise

Elior Group competes with Compass Group in the contract catering space, specifically targeting the European business and industry markets. While Compass Group operates at a massive global scale, Elior Group offers a more agile, localized approach to menu customization, making it a preferred alternative for clients seeking regional culinary expertise.

ISS

Facility Services ProviderEnterprise

ISS World competes with Compass Group in the integrated facility services sector. While Compass Group prioritizes food as its primary service pillar, ISS World focuses on cleaning, security, and technical maintenance. Clients often compare these alternatives when deciding whether to prioritize culinary quality or comprehensive facility management operational efficiency.

ABM Industries

Facility Solutions ProviderEnterprise

ABM Industries competes with Compass Group in the North American facilities management market. Unlike Compass Group’s food-centric model, ABM focuses heavily on technical engineering and janitorial services. Buyers choose ABM when their primary requirement is infrastructure maintenance and building performance rather than high-end corporate dining or hospitality services.

Market overview

The contract foodservice market is dominated by large global players that compete on scale, culinary innovation, and integrated facility management capabilities. Decision factors typically include service reliability, regional culinary expertise, and the ability to bundle food services with broader facility maintenance.
